UT Health San Antonio School of Nursing leads training to save lives of opioid users

April 26, 2018

SAN ANTONIO (April 26, 2018) ― The UT Health San Antonio School of Nursing has been awarded two grants totaling more than $4 million to educate Bexar County first responders in how to identify and reverse opioid overdose. Employee, student clinics address mental health issues

February 22, 2018

Health care providers in the Employee Health & Wellness Center and the Student Health & Wellness Center at UT Health San Antonio have integrated a mental health component into their primary care services.
